Character of the water

Yttersjön lies in the south — a southern mesotrophic lake.

The surroundings

The lake lies half-remote, a fair way from the nearest road, tucked into woodland.

Shallow throughout (max 4 m), with reeds and vegetation over large areas — water that warms fast in spring.

Permits & rules

Fishing permit required — Yttersjön FVOF. Day permit ~60 kr · annual permit ~300 kr.

  • Pike: keep at most one over 75 cm per day.
  • Handheld tackle only. Respect the protected zones at the inlets and outlets.
